Dutch Minister Adema of Agriculture, Nature and Food Quality has recently presented the action plan "Growth of Organic Production and Consumption" to the Dutch Parliament, which includes the ambition of 15% organic farming area by 2030.
The growth of organic is part of an acceleration towards more sustainable food production.
Organic agriculture in the Netherlands can play an important role in the transition to a sustainable and future-proof agriculture. With this action plan, we as the central government set out the ambition to substantially increase organic production and consumption. The actions are a starting point to work together with chain parties.

Hello, my name is Cog! We grow your organic grapes in South Africa. The farm is located in the Northern Cape where we benefit from the water of the mighty Orange River. This area is known for its extreme climate. Temperatures vary between cold winters where temperatures reach –5 C, and very hot summers with highs of 35-45 C. With only 150 mm of precipitation, it enjoys little rainfall. Due to the closeness to South Africa's longest river, there is ample water for irrigation”. We save water with the best computer technology and drip or micro irrigation.
